The way people shop for homes is changing rapidly, and virtual tours are leading the transformation. By allowing buyers to explore properties from anywhere, virtual tours make home shopping more convenient, efficient, and accessible than ever before. As technology continues to advance, virtual tours are becoming an essential tool in modern real estate.


What Are Virtual Tours?

Virtual tours use 3D imaging, panoramic photography, and interactive technology to create a digital walkthrough of a property. Buyers can move through rooms, view details from different angles, and experience the home's layout without physically visiting the property.


Convenience for Buyers

One of the biggest advantages of virtual tours is convenience. Buyers can explore multiple properties from their computer, tablet, or smartphone at any time. This saves travel time and helps narrow down options before scheduling in-person visits.


Expanded Reach for Sellers

Virtual tours allow sellers to showcase their homes to a larger audience, including out-of-town and international buyers. Properties with virtual tours often attract more interest because potential buyers can experience the home before arranging a showing.


Better Qualified Leads

When buyers have already explored a property online, they are more likely to schedule showings only for homes they are seriously considering. This helps realtors and sellers focus on qualified prospects.


Enhanced Property Presentation

Virtual tours provide a more immersive experience than traditional photos. Buyers can understand room sizes, flow between spaces, and overall property layout more accurately, reducing surprises during in-person visits.


Supports Remote Home Buying

As remote work becomes more common, many buyers relocate to different cities or states. Virtual tours make it possible to evaluate properties from anywhere, helping buyers make informed decisions without extensive travel.


Integration with Virtual Reality

Emerging virtual reality (VR) technology is taking virtual tours to the next level. With VR headsets, buyers can feel as though they are physically walking through a property, creating an even more realistic experience.


Saves Time for Realtors

Virtual tours help agents reduce unnecessary showings and streamline the buying process. Realtors can spend more time assisting serious buyers and less time coordinating visits for those who may not be interested after seeing the property.


Competitive Advantage for Listings

Listings that include virtual tours often stand out from competing properties. They provide additional value to buyers and demonstrate that the seller and agent are embracing modern marketing techniques.


The Future of Home Shopping

As technology continues to evolve, virtual tours are expected to become a standard feature in real estate marketing. Advances in 3D imaging, artificial intelligence, and virtual reality will make online property exploration even more interactive and realistic.


Conclusion

Virtual tours are revolutionizing the home-buying experience by making property shopping more convenient, efficient, and accessible. They help buyers make informed decisions, give sellers greater exposure, and enable realtors to market homes more effectively. As digital technology advances, virtual tours will play an increasingly important role in the future of real estate.
